Chapter 162 - 162 Fighting The Wrong Enemy

Micheal immediately hit a symbol on the wall sending an emergency signal to the wheelhouse causing them to speed up. The ship lurched forward as wind magic pushed the ship's speed to its limits.

As Chronos stepped onto the deck he saw pillars of black smoke rising up to the sky in the distance. A moment later a message came through his system from Micheal.

{Black beasts are in the village! I've seen steppe wolves, wild horses, and a disturbing number of horned rabbits and burrow drakes. I can confirm at least one sun badger as well.}

Most of those creatures were pack type beasts or animals making them difficult to fight when they grouped up like this, but that sun badger was going to be a problem. Despite not being very powerful, sun badgers were extremely ferocious and could absorb the power of the sun to heal from almost any injury. Which just made them fight even harder.

Chronos had heard that fighting them was a pain, but he was looking forward to it.

Since evening was approaching, he would have to hurry before the badger lost its healing ability when the sun set. Otherwise, it wouldn't be any fun.

{Captain, fly low! I'm going after the badger!} He sent to the ship's captain.

The guards assembled on the deck as the village's real situation came into view.

It had both an outer wall and an inner wall with the inner wall set on a hill where the village head could easily defend the populace. From the size of it Chronos classified it as a town with a small fort on the hill, but it wasn't the size of a city yet.

He didn't remember seeing a named town on the maps that Micheal had shown him and wondered how such a large place didn't have a name.

Unfortunately, he didn't have time to think any further. The black beasts had broken through the outer palisade and were ransacking the village, but it didn't look like they had broken through the inner wall yet.

Chronos could still see archers and mages shooting from the walls and commoners dropping rocks and other items from the top of the wall. If they had commoners on the wall, then their situation was growing worse by the minute.

Some of the archers on the wall saw them as they passed over the outer wall and fired arrows at them. Ignoring the arrows Chronos prepared to leap off of the ship when Lyla jumped on his back.

"You're not going down there without me!" She said with determination.

"Fine by me but don't get separated from me. Against this many enemies fighting alone is a death sentence. Also, do you see a sun badger anywhere?"

"Hm, over there!" She pointed at a gap in the beast tide where a single black badger the size of a large dog was lying down.

From the way the other black beasts were carefully circling it without entering its territory it was clear that all of them were afraid of it. With that size and presence, it had to be a third rank beast.

Chronos smiled as he motioned for the captain to drop lower.

"Hold on!" He said as he leapt from the ship just 30 meters above the ground.

The ship dropped so low that several of the black beasts tried attacking the bottom of the ship when Chronos jumped off.

Falling through the air he applied [Adhesion] to his hands and feet, latching onto a tall wall he used it to slow himself down.

"Ugh."

But still hit the ground hard enough to feel a slight pain in his knees.

Transforming into a werewolf he took off running towards the badger while Lyla started throwing down [Lawbound Bulwarks] behind them.

Several wild horses tried to trample them, but Chronos easily cut their heads off and ignored any beast that wasn't in his way.

As he charged at the badger it sensed his approach.

"Grrr." Growling, it stood up and faced Chronos as he entered a ring that no beast seemed brave enough to enter.

Lyla hopped off his back and threw down two more bulwarks before casting [Holy Gavel].

"I'll make sure nothing interrupts your fight. Finish this quickly so we can help the hill fort." She ordered.

"No problem." Chronos growled as he took out Echoforge.

He could have used a weapon he had reached full mastery with, but he wanted to master more weapons. Out of the weapons he currently carried, only the bow and hammer were not yet at full mastery.

He had never trained for using the bow in close combat, so he decided to use Echoforge instead.

Waving his hammer in front of him he provoked the badger, its fur lit up with golden flames as it snarled at him.

Not giving it a chance to power up further Chronos rushed forward and swung down at it, but the badger just roared and jumped at him causing Echoforge to bounce off of its thick hide. Chronos grunted as it knocked him over then kicked its midriff launching it off of him.

Hm!? Why did it feel so solid? Most black beasts felt like soft fur, but this badger was like a lump of rocks. He could think about that after he won this fight.

He jumped to his feet just as the badger rolled over and charged again.

Sidestepping the charge, he tried to hit its backside, but the badger planted its front feet and rapidly pivoted, throwing its rear in front of it. Chronos's hammer whisked through the air as the badger lowered its body and jumped at him again.

Chronos pulled the shaft back using it to block the badger's mouth then charged forward slamming it into a wall.

It growled at him and locked its legs around his waist before punching the wall behind it. The wall collapsed as both of them tumbled inside swiftly turning the fight into a brawl as they wrestled on the floor. Which Chronos was swiftly coming to regret.

Bang!

He blocked another low blow. "Damn it! Why does it keep aiming for my crotch!? This thing fights dirty."

Grabbing a fistful of fur Chronos managed to rip it off of him but lost his grip as its flexible hide slipped out of his hand.

It jumped back and growled at him while the flames healed its body. Watching it rapidly recover Chronos wondered if this was how his opponents felt when he kept getting up after taking heavy blows.

Looking at its face Chronos realized that it was smiling. Was this thing enjoying the fight?

An eager smile crossed his own face as he discovered that he had found something that liked to fight just as much as he did.

As they gathered energy for the next round a howl distracted both of them.

"Howl!" Crash!

Black wolves burst through the windows and doors aiming for their vitals.

Chronos scowled as he swung Echoforge at the nearest wolf crushing its spine in a single blow. Spinning around prepared to face the onslaught of the wolves and badger together, he was surprised when several wolves turned on the badger and tried to bite through its throat.

Its thick hide bunched up around its neck preventing them from doing any real damage to it. Roaring it shook its body, throwing them off and tore one of their throats out before turning on the rest in a rage.

"They aren't allies? Wait, does the sun badger have black fur when it's not on fire!? And its body was far too solid for a black beast! Come to think of it, black beasts smell rotten too, but this one smells like a sun-touched field." Chronos was beginning to believe he had made a mistake in attacking the badger.

While he was thinking, a large alpha wolf charged in the door. Four wolves latched onto the badger's limbs holding it in place as the alpha moved to bite its face off.

He couldn't let that happen. Stepping forward Chronos swung Echoforge at the alpha wolf's head before it could react to him.

Boom! Boom!

Two echoes exploded as the alpha wolf's head was pulverized.

The badger glared at him wondering why its enemy had suddenly assisted it.

"I thought you were one of these damn black beasts and attacked you. I'm sorry about that." Chronos explained as he crushed two more wolves freeing the sun badger.

It ripped the heads off the last two wolves before spinning to face him. It glared at him for a few moments before snorting, seeming to accept his apology.

They jumped out of the house together to find Lyla fighting off 6 wolves on her own while other black beasts were pressing against the bulwarks blocking entry to the yard.

"Looks like there are plenty of beasts to fight. Let's head for the fort now." Chronos said as he ran to help Lyla.

Growling in agreement the badger launched itself at a wild horse that had forced its way past a bulwark.
